What Off-Duty Police Officers Can Do at Events
Off-duty police officers are often used for event security because they bring public-safety training, experience with crowds, and the ability to stay composed during tense situations. Their role can be visible or discreet depending on the event, venue, and security plan.
- Monitor entrances, exits, and restricted areas
- Support guest check-in and access control
- Help manage parking lots and traffic flow
- De-escalate conflicts before they grow
- Watch for suspicious behavior or safety concerns
- Assist with emergency communication when needed
- Coordinate with venue staff, organizers, or public safety personnel
Baltimore off-duty police event security is especially useful when an event expects large crowds, alcohol service, VIP guests, expensive equipment, public access, cash handling, or sensitive locations.

How to Plan Event Security the Right Way
The best security plan starts before the event day. Organizers should think through the venue layout, expected attendance, parking, entrances, emergency access, alcohol service, closing time, vendor movement, and any past concerns at the location.
It can also help to review city requirements and planning resources. For larger public events, Baltimore’s Special Events information explains why advanced public-safety coordination matters. Security providers do not replace required permits or public-agency requirements, but they can support a more complete plan.
Questions to Ask Before Hiring Event Security
Before hiring a team for Baltimore off-duty police event security, ask practical questions that connect directly to the event details.
- How many guests are expected?
- Will alcohol be served?
- Are there multiple entrances or restricted areas?
- Will the event be indoors, outdoors, or both?
- Is parking or traffic control needed?
- Are there VIP guests, cash handling, or high-value equipment?
- What time does the event start, peak, and end?
- Who should security report to during the event?

Frequently Asked Questions About Baltimore Off-Duty Police Event Security
Do all events need off-duty police security?
No. Some small private events may only need basic planning or venue staff. Baltimore off-duty police event security becomes more important when there are larger crowds, public access, alcohol service, VIP guests, parking concerns, or a higher need for trained response.
Will security make guests uncomfortable?
Professional security should fit the event. The right team can be visible enough to deter problems while still being respectful and approachable.
How early should I plan event security?
The earlier, the better. Planning ahead gives the security team time to review the venue, schedule, guest count, risk points, and staffing needs.
Can security help with parking and entrances?
Yes, depending on the event plan. Security may help monitor entry points, guide guests, support access control, and watch parking areas.
